Damian Priest Set To Defend World Heavyweight Title vs. Jey Uso At WWE SmackDown Tapings In Madison Square Garden On 6/28

Madison Square Garden has announced a World Heavyweight Championship match will take place on the night of June 28, 2024.

On June 28, WWE SmackDown will be heading to Madison Square Garden but as a special treat, a top match from Monday Night Raw will be held as a dark match for the fans in the arena.

Madison Square Garden announced that Damian Priest will go against Jey Uso on June 28. As of now, the match is scheduled to be for the WWE World Heavyweight Title. Priest is scheduled to defend the title against Drew McIntyre at WWE Clash at the Castle on June 15.

It is unknown how the match will change if Drew McIntyre wins the championship and whether or not he will then step in to defend the championship against Jey Uso or if Priest versus Uso will take place that evening regardless.

As always in professional wrestling, the card is subject to change.

Priest defeated Uso back at WWE Backlash in France and should he make it to SummerSlam as champion, he will have to defend the championship against the 2024 King of the Ring Gunther.
